在数字化转型的浪潮中,企业对数据的依赖程度日益增加。DataWorks作为一种高效的数据管理与分析平台,帮助企业构建数据中台、实现数字孪生和数字可视化,从而赋能业务决策。然而,在实际应用中,DataWorks的迁移是一项复杂且具有挑战性的任务。本文将深入解析DataWorks迁移的高效方案,并分享实践中的技巧,帮助企业顺利完成迁移,最大化数据价值。
在进行DataWorks迁移之前,企业需要充分了解迁移过程中可能面临的挑战,以便制定合理的应对策略。
数据规模与复杂性DataWorks通常处理海量数据,包括结构化、半结构化和非结构化数据。迁移过程中,数据量大、类型多样可能导致性能瓶颈和数据丢失风险。
系统兼容性问题DataWorks迁移可能涉及不同版本的平台或不同厂商的系统,兼容性问题可能导致功能缺失或性能下降。
数据一致性与完整性数据在迁移过程中可能因网络中断、系统故障等原因导致数据不一致或丢失,影响业务的连续性。
团队能力与资源限制DataWorks迁移需要专业的技术团队和充足的资源支持。如果团队经验不足或资源有限,可能导致迁移失败或进度延迟。
为了应对迁移过程中的挑战,企业可以采用以下高效方案:
数据评估与清理在迁移前,企业需要对现有数据进行全面评估,清理冗余数据、修复数据质量问题(如重复、空值、不一致等),确保数据的完整性和一致性。
系统兼容性分析对目标系统进行全面兼容性测试,确保DataWorks与目标平台的硬件、软件和插件兼容,避免迁移后功能异常。
团队培训与资源规划为团队提供迁移相关的培训,确保团队成员熟悉迁移流程和技术细节。同时,合理规划资源,确保迁移过程中有足够的计算资源和存储资源支持。
数据抽取使用DataWorks提供的数据抽取工具,将源数据从原系统中安全、高效地提取出来。注意选择合适的数据抽取方式(如全量抽取或增量抽取),以减少对源系统的压力。
数据清洗与转换在迁移过程中,对数据进行清洗和转换,确保数据格式、字段名称和数据类型与目标系统一致。例如,将日期格式统一为ISO标准格式,或将字段名称从“旧命名”转换为“新命名”。
数据加载将清洗和转换后的数据加载到目标系统中。在加载过程中,注意控制数据加载的批次大小,避免一次性加载过多数据导致目标系统崩溃。
数据验证在数据加载完成后,对目标系统中的数据进行验证,确保数据的完整性和一致性。可以通过对比源数据和目标数据的统计信息(如数据量、字段分布等)来确认数据是否正确迁移。
性能调优在迁移完成后,对目标系统进行全面的性能调优。例如,优化数据库的查询计划、调整缓存策略、优化分布式计算任务的资源分配等,以提升系统的运行效率。
系统稳定性测试对目标系统进行长时间的稳定性测试,确保在高并发、大流量的情况下系统能够稳定运行。可以通过模拟真实业务场景的测试来验证系统的稳定性。
数据一致性验证在系统优化完成后,再次对目标系统中的数据进行一致性验证,确保数据在迁移过程中没有丢失或损坏。
数据监控在目标系统中部署数据监控工具,实时监控数据的完整性、准确性和可用性。例如,使用DataWorks的监控功能,设置数据变更的告警规则,及时发现并处理数据异常。
系统维护与更新定期对目标系统进行维护和更新,确保系统能够适应业务发展的需求。例如,定期更新系统补丁、优化系统配置、清理无效数据等。
用户培训与支持对目标系统的用户进行培训,确保用户能够熟练使用新系统。同时,建立完善的技术支持体系,及时解决用户在使用过程中遇到的问题。
为了确保DataWorks迁移的顺利进行,以下是一些实践技巧:
分阶段实施将迁移过程分为多个阶段,逐步完成数据迁移和系统优化。例如,先迁移核心业务数据,再迁移非核心业务数据;先完成数据迁移,再进行系统优化。
使用自动化工具利用DataWorks提供的自动化迁移工具,减少人工操作,提高迁移效率。例如,使用DataWorks的ETL工具进行数据抽取、清洗和加载,减少手动操作的错误率。
制定详细的迁移计划在迁移前,制定详细的迁移计划,明确每个阶段的任务、时间节点和责任人。例如,制定一个包含迁移准备、数据迁移、系统优化和迁移总结的详细计划。
建立应急预案在迁移过程中,可能会遇到各种突发情况(如网络中断、系统崩溃等)。因此,企业需要提前制定应急预案,确保在出现问题时能够快速恢复。
注重数据安全在迁移过程中,企业需要高度重视数据的安全性。例如,对敏感数据进行加密处理,确保数据在迁移过程中的安全性;对迁移后的数据进行访问权限控制,防止未经授权的访问。
DataWorks迁移不仅是一项技术任务,更是企业数字化转型的重要一步。通过高效、安全的迁移,企业可以实现以下长期价值:
提升数据资产的利用效率通过DataWorks迁移,企业可以将分散在各个系统中的数据整合到统一的数据平台中,从而提升数据资产的利用效率。
优化业务决策DataWorks迁移后,企业可以利用统一的数据平台进行数据分析和挖掘,从而优化业务决策,提升企业的竞争力。
增强数据驱动的创新能力DataWorks迁移后,企业可以利用数据平台的强大功能,快速开发和部署数据驱动的应用,从而增强企业的创新能力。
如果您正在计划进行DataWorks迁移,或者对数据中台、数字孪生和数字可视化感兴趣,不妨申请试用相关工具和服务。通过实践,您可以更深入地了解DataWorks的功能和价值,为企业的数字化转型提供有力支持。
申请试用 & https://www.dtstack.com/?src=bbs
通过本文的解析与实践技巧,相信您已经对DataWorks迁移有了更深入的理解。无论是数据评估、系统兼容性分析,还是数据清洗、迁移后的系统优化,都需要企业投入足够的资源和精力。希望本文的内容能够为您的DataWorks迁移提供有价值的参考,帮助您顺利完成迁移,实现数据价值的最大化。
申请试用&下载资料